Transaction 26506a813016f70252d32ee3b2077b03728b8cbbf862b9e77431fc0328bfe074
1 Input
2 Outputs
- 26506a813016f70252d32ee3b2077b03728b8cbbf862b9e77431fc0328bfe074:0
- 26506a813016f70252d32ee3b2077b03728b8cbbf862b9e77431fc0328bfe074:1
value 100000
address 346SonDQndZsN9fKCCftUtmvVSeBie2tvy
value 719787
address 1EYq3iMoHrWPBQeQhuShyzQJ3CTvxF5Gmj